Giter VIP home page Giter VIP logo

gpt-translate's Introduction

Snow Crash ⛄

trophy

me me

🦔 < hi NVIDIA
  • 🌱 I’m currently learning: Web Dev
  • 💬 Ask me about: Anythin! / Sci-Fi movie
  • 💙 I LOVE BUILDING COMPUTERS!! [M-ITX mainly]
    • My Baby Specs
    • Ryzen™ 9 5950X
    • GEFORCE RTX 3090
    • 64GB RAM & M.2 2TB

gpt-translate's People

Contributors

3ru avatar dependabot[bot] avatar github-actions[bot] av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

gpt-translate's Issues

Multiple file extension I/O

Ideal

/g website/**/*.{md,mdx,json} website/**/*.ja.{md,mdx,json} 

memo

  • The output ext must have the same length as the input ext.
    • The ext order should be the same.
  • Allowed to set extension prefix on output

error 429

Link to the environment that reproduces this issue or a replay of the bug

No response

To Reproduce

not sure why always happened

Current vs. Expected behavior

2/3/2024, 2:33:33 PM Start translating with gpt-4...
Error: Error: Request failed with status code 429
Notice: If the status code is 400, the file exceeds token limit without line breaks.
Please open one line as appropriate.
Notice: If the status code is 404, you do not have right access to the model.

Provide environment information

using gpt-4

after topping up to my openapi , the situation still happened

How do you run translations?

By Command

Additional context

No response

Automated usage after every commit

Hi, I tried to integrate your tool in my workflow with the intention that after every commit from GitBook it translates automatically every changed file into specified languages.

Unfortunately I get an error message because the path to push the issue-comment was not found.
Maybe you can adjust that to make it usable also after every commit?

thanks in advance :)

【DEMO】Playground

This issue is for a test run of GPT-Translate.
The command executes permission is for a user with repository write permission (collaborator or above).

Note
If you write a command in an issue, it will not be executed.
It must always be written on the comment side.

"Cards" table doesn't get transferred properly

Hi @3ru

I need to report an other error:

I created a type of table in GitBook called "Cards":
image

code looks this way:

<table data-view="cards" data-full-width="true">
   <thead>
      <tr>
         <th></th>
         <th data-hidden data-card-cover
            data-type="files"></th>
      </tr>
   </thead>
   <tbody>
      <tr>
         <td>
            <p>
               <img
                  src="../.gitbook/assets/image (7).png" alt="">
            </p>
            <p>Prior to founding XBorg, he contributed to well-known DAOs (CityDAO, MakerDAO) and has relevant experiences in traditional finance and quant with Rothschild &#x26; Co and Credit Suisse. Louis spent most of his childhood grinding out Call Of Duty and remains an active FPS player. At XBorg, he single-handedly developed the gaming passport alpha and led the roadmap execution, strategy and fundraising.</p>
         </td>
         <td></td>
      </tr>
      <tr>
         <td>
            <p><img
               src="../.gitbook/assets/image (11).png" alt=""></p>
            <p>With more than 14 years of experience in software development, she joined SwissBorg as a Senior Software Engineer to build an infrastructure now used by more than 700,000 users before joining XBorg to lead the tech team. On the side, Laureline is an avid gamer, regularly leading 30+ player raids on Final Fantasy, or ruling Minecraft servers like no other.</p>
         </td>
         <td></td>
      </tr>
      <tr>
         <td>
            <p><img
               src="../.gitbook/assets/image (12).png" alt=""></p>
            <p>With a wealth of experience in the industry, Arthur has worked on a diverse range of projects, including personal websites, e-commerce platforms, and banking applications. In his free time, Arthur enjoys gaming, particularly strategy and racing games. He finds that the strategic thinking required in these games translates well to his work as a software engineer, where he excels at finding creative solutions to complex problems.</p>
         </td>
         <td></td>
      </tr>
      <tr>
         <td>
            <p><img
               src="../.gitbook/assets/image (1).png" alt=""></p>
            <p>Backend developer at XBorg that specializes in building scalable web applications and prior to XBorg has developed several e-commerce applications and worked on a Banking application. In his free time, loves to play indie or MMORPG’s and if there is an achievement system in place, he's sure to go for 100% completion of those achievements.</p>
         </td>
         <td></td>
      </tr>
      <tr>
         <td>
            <p><img
               src="../.gitbook/assets/image (2).png" alt=""></p>
            <p>After three years of entrepreneurship, Gauthier joined PrimeDAO to design new models for startup incubation. Initially a community member, he was drawn to XBorg's vision and joined the project. Gauthier now supports the different teams and ongoing projects to ensure XBorg is headed in the right direction. With a deep understanding of the gaming industry, hours spent in-game leading guilds, and experience in high-growth startups, Gauthier brings his jack-of-all-trades approach to the team.</p>
         </td>
         <td></td>
      </tr>
      <tr>
         <td>
            <p><img
               src="../.gitbook/assets/image (15).png" alt=""></p>
            <p>A multi-talented designer, artist, and musician with a decade of experience. Before joining XBorg he launched a clothing brand, worked as a brand designer for 7 years, and then evolved into a product designer. Life mission - helping people build high-impact products that contribute to the growth and evolution of the world. As design lead at XBorg, he's a true creative force crafting innovative and visually stunning designs. He fully rebranded XBorg to share the looks of the best gaming brands and elevated the company to a higher level.</p>
         </td>
         <td></td>
      </tr>
      <tr>
         <td>
            <p><img
               src="../.gitbook/assets/image (6).png" alt=""></p>
            <p>leveraging his 15 years of finance experience (investment advisor and private banker) from Société Générale to create educational crypto content. He is also a former brand ambassador and DAO member of SwissBorg. He is an avid player of management games like Civilization and EuroGames-style board games. As ITO Project Manager at XBorg, he contributes esports teams create sustainable environments to engage and retain their fans.</p>
         </td>
         <td></td>
      </tr>
      <tr>
         <td>
            <p><img
               src="../.gitbook/assets/image.png" alt=""></p>
            <p>Connor Kirsten leads Growth and Marketing at XBorg. Previously an active member of the African startup scene and skilled in business development, marketing and growth-hacking, Connor founded a digital asset exchange and an online venue-booking platform before joining XBorg. Since then, he has led the Prometheus NFT sale, the Xtreme Championship Series and has scaled XBorg's social following by 100x. Connor spends his free time playing Rocket League, Call of Duty and God of War.</p>
         </td>
         <td></td>
      </tr>
      <tr>
         <td>
            <p><img
               src="../.gitbook/assets/image (8).png" alt=""></p>
            <p>The Investment and Advisory lead at XBorg, with a history of social and financial analyses. He spearheads the launchpad and and co-authored the Whitepaper V1, while having developed the advisory arm "XBorg ventures" and content arm of the organization. Additionally, with +20,000 of playtime, Sam aims to pioneer the future of gaming and bridge the gap between Web2 and Web3</p>
         </td>
         <td></td>
      </tr>
      <tr>
         <td>
            <p></p>
            <p><img
               src="../.gitbook/assets/image (9).png" alt="">Esports lead for XBorg, Former Counter-Strike Pro, Business developer for CS Manager. Experienced in blockchain and gaming projects: Business developer for Vanilla Network; Community Manager for SinVerse. At XBorg he single-handedly built the best web3 esports team, winning + 70 tournaments &#x26; +60k in prize pool.</p>
         </td>
         <td></td>
      </tr>
      <tr>
         <td>
            <p><img
               src="../.gitbook/assets/image (3).png" alt=""></p>
            <p>Head of community at XBorg, I am a true adventurer at heart, with a passion for gaming, community living, and exploring new horizons. With over 10 years of experience in fly test design, I have honed my analytical skills and problem-solving abilities. But it's my travels around the world, including a special stop in Brazil, that have truly shaped my outlook on life and my desire to create new paradigms in community building. As an avid player, I am constantly seeking new challenges and ways to push my limits, both in gaming and in life.</p>
         </td>
         <td></td>
      </tr>
      <tr>
         <td>
            <p><img
               src="../.gitbook/assets/image (10).png" alt=""></p>
            <p>Designer and Editor at XBorg. Prior to joining Xborg, he created 3D/videos and worked for well established esports orgs such as FNATIC, NRG, Heretics, T1, Shopify and more. Sean has always been an active gamer since childhood, with his dominant category being competitive FPS games such as COD, CSGO, Valorant and Apex reaching the top 1% in most. Since joining XBorg, he has created a variety of content such as 3D work, announcement videos and motion graphics, while aiming to contribute to the exponential growth of XBorg</p>
         </td>
         <td></td>
      </tr>
   </tbody>
</table>

but I get no images nor the right formatting:

image

code after translation:

| | |
|-|-|
| ![image (7).png](../.gitbook/assets/image (7).png) | Avant de fonder XBorg, il a contribué à des DAO bien connus (CityDAO, MakerDAO) et possède une expérience pertinente dans la finance traditionnelle et la quantification avec Rothschild & Co et Credit Suisse. Louis a passé la majeure partie de son enfance à jouer à Call Of Duty et reste un joueur FPS actif. Chez XBorg, il a développé seul le passeport de jeu alpha et a dirigé l'exécution de la feuille de route, la stratégie et la collecte de fonds. |
| ![image (11).png](../.gitbook/assets/image (11).png) | Avec plus de 14 ans d'expérience dans le développement de logiciels, elle a rejoint SwissBorg en tant qu'ingénieure logiciel senior pour construire une infrastructure utilisée par plus de 700 000 utilisateurs avant de rejoindre XBorg pour diriger l'équipe technique. À côté, Laureline est une joueuse passionnée, menant régulièrement des raids de plus de 30 joueurs sur Final Fantasy ou dominant les serveurs Minecraft comme personne d'autre. |
| ![image (12).png](../.gitbook/assets/image (12).png) | Avec une grande expérience dans l'industrie, Arthur a travaillé sur une gamme diversifiée de projets, y compris des sites web personnels, des plateformes de commerce électronique et des applications bancaires. Dans ses temps libres, Arthur aime les jeux vidéo, en particulier les jeux de stratégie et de course. Il trouve que la réflexion stratégique requise dans ces jeux se traduit bien dans son travail en tant qu'ingénieur logiciel, où il excelle à trouver des solutions créatives à des problèmes complexes. |
| ![image (1).png](../.gitbook/assets/image (1).png) | Développeur backend chez XBorg, spécialisé dans la construction d'applications web évolutives, il a développé plusieurs applications de commerce électronique et travaillé sur une application bancaire avant de rejoindre XBorg. Dans ses temps libres, il aime jouer à des jeux indépendants ou MMORPG, et s'il y a un système de réalisations en place, il est sûr de viser une réalisation à 100%. |
| ![image (2).png](../.gitbook/assets/image (2).png) | Après trois ans d'entrepreneuriat, Gauthier a rejoint PrimeDAO pour concevoir de nouveaux modèles d'incubation de startups. Initialement membre de la communauté, il a été attiré par la vision de XBorg et a rejoint le projet. Gauthier soutient maintenant les différentes équipes et projets en cours pour s'assurer que XBorg est sur la bonne voie. Avec une compréhension approfondie de l'industrie du jeu, des heures passées en jeu à diriger des guildes et une expérience dans les startups à forte croissance, Gauthier apporte son approche touche-à-tout à l'équipe. |
| ![image (15).png](../.gitbook/assets/image (15).png) | Designer, artiste et musicien aux multiples talents avec une décennie d'expérience. Avant de rejoindre XBorg, il a lancé une marque de vêtements, travaillé comme designer de marque pendant 7 ans, puis est devenu designer de produits. Sa mission de vie est d'aider les gens à construire des produits à fort impact qui contribuent à la croissance et à l'évolution du monde. En tant que responsable du design chez XBorg, il est une véritable force créative qui crée des designs innovants et visuellement époustouflants. Il a entièrement rebrandé XBorg pour partager l'apparence des meilleures marques de jeux et a élevé l'entreprise à un niveau supérieur. |
| ![image (6).png](../.gitbook/assets/image (6).png) | En tirant parti de ses 15 années d'expérience en finance (conseiller en investissement et banquier privé) chez Société Générale pour créer du contenu éducatif sur la crypto. Il est également un ancien ambassadeur de marque et membre de DAO de SwissBorg. Il est un joueur passionné de jeux de gestion tels que Civilization et les jeux de société de style EuroGames. En tant que responsable de projet ITO chez XBorg, il contribue à la création d'environnements durables pour les équipes d'esports afin d'impliquer et de fidéliser leurs fans. |
| ![image.png](../.gitbook/assets/image.png) | Connor Kirsten dirige la croissance et le marketing chez XBorg. Auparavant, membre actif de la scène des startups africaines et compétent en développement commercial, marketing et growth-hacking, Connor a fondé une plateforme d'échange d'actifs numériques et une plateforme de réservation de lieux en ligne avant de rejoindre XBorg. Depuis lors, il a dirigé la vente de NFT Prometheus, la Xtreme Championship Series et a multiplié par 100 le nombre d'abonnés sur les réseaux sociaux de XBorg. Connor passe son temps libre à jouer à Rocket League, Call of Duty et God of War. |
| ![image (8).png](../.gitbook/assets/image (8).png) | Le responsable des investissements et des conseils chez XBorg, avec une expérience en analyse sociale et financière. Il est à l'origine du lancement du launchpad et a co-écrit le Livre Blanc V1, tout en ayant développé la branche conseil "XBorg ventures" et la branche contenu de l'organisation. De plus, avec plus de 20 000 heures de jeu, Sam vise à être un pionnier de l'avenir du jeu et à combler le fossé entre Web2 et Web3. |
| ![image (9).png](../.gitbook/assets/image (9).png) | Responsable des esports chez XBorg, ancien joueur professionnel de Counter-Strike, développeur commercial pour CS Manager. Expérimenté dans les projets blockchain et de jeux : développeur commercial pour Vanilla Network ; responsable de communauté pour SinVerse. Chez XBorg, il a construit seul la meilleure équipe d'esports web3, remportant plus de 70 tournois et plus de 60 000 $ de prix. |
| ![image (3).png](../.gitbook/assets/image (3).png) | Responsable de la communauté chez XBorg, je suis un véritable aventurier dans l'âme, avec une passion pour les jeux, la vie en communauté et l'exploration de nouveaux horizons. Avec plus de 10 ans d'expérience dans la conception de tests de vol, j'ai affiné mes compétences analytiques et mes capacités de résolution de problèmes. Mais ce sont mes voyages à travers le monde, y compris un arrêt spécial au Brésil, qui ont vraiment façonné ma vision de la vie et mon désir de créer de nouveaux paradigmes dans la construction de communautés. En tant que joueur passionné, je suis constamment à la recherche de nouveaux défis et de nouvelles façons de repousser mes limites, tant dans les jeux que dans la vie. |
| ![image (10).png](../.gitbook/assets/image (10).png) | Designer et éditeur chez XBorg. Avant de rejoindre Xborg, il a créé des vidéos 3D et travaillé pour des organisations d'esports bien établies telles que FNATIC, NRG, Heretics, T1, Shopify et d'autres. Sean a toujours été un joueur actif depuis son enfance, sa catégorie dominante étant les jeux de tir à la première personne compétitifs tels que COD, CSGO, Valorant et Apex, atteignant le top 1% dans la plupart d'entre eux. Depuis qu'il a rejoint XBorg, il a créé divers contenus tels que des travaux 3D, des vidéos d'annonce et des graphiques animés, tout en visant à contribuer à la croissance exponentielle de XBorg. |

GPT 4

Hi @3ru I know have access to the API from GPT 4.
Is it possible to use this engine then?

Error: Request failed with status code 502

Thanks for your wonderful action! I just tried it, but got Error: Request failed with status code 502.

I have added the billing information to get a paid account. And what I used to trigger this action is: /gpt-translate README.md zh-CN/README.md simplified-chinese.

image

test chinese

/gpt-translate README.md README_zh.md traditional-chinese

API Key Error

Hello there!

I'm trying to translate content using your action, however, I keep getting this error 'AI_APICallError: The model gpt-4o does not exist or you do not have access to it.' even though I'm using a paid OpenAI account. I even added my manager as a collaborator and tried running the action on his computer to no effect.

Please advice.

page-structure not inherited

do you have any idea how to inherit the page-tree when translating the content?

I tried to translate the whole directory with an issue-comment but it doesn't inherit the whole path from original path.

token limit exceeded

Hi :)

I made a lot changes in original content. Then I got this issue:

Error: Request failed with status code 503
Error: If the status code is 400, the file exceeds 16,000 tokens without line breaks.

Is there a limit of characters to translate? Could you split them by files or sentences?

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.